What does the Internet2 SALSA-NetAuth group do?
The SALSA-NetAuth Working Group considers the data requirements, implementation, integration, and automation technologies associated with understanding and extending network security management related to providing identification, registration, and authorized access services to campus networks. Generally, the outputs of the group include producing whitepapers, maintaining this wiki, presenting at conferences, and developing effective practices is use at campuses. Participation in the group is open to members of EDUCAUSE or Internet2. The working group operates under the umbrella of SALSA and the EDUCAUSE/Internet2 Security Task Force.
